Essential Ingredients
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:
- Low-Carb Tortillas: Opt for high-quality tortillas that are flexible but sturdy enough to hold all the cheesy goodness inside.
- Shredded Mozzarella Cheese: Go for whole milk mozzarella; it melts beautifully and gives those irresistible stretchy cheese pulls.
- Pepperoni Slices: Choose your favorite brand; the spicier the better! It adds a nice kick of flavor.
- Italian Seasoning: A blend of herbs that perfectly complements the pizza flavors; it elevates the taste profile significantly.
- Garlic Powder: Just a pinch adds depth and enhances the overall flavor without overpowering other ingredients.
- Olive Oil Spray: Helps achieve that golden-brown finish when baking; it keeps everything moist while adding flavor.

Let’s Make it together
Preheat Your Oven: Set your oven to 400°F (200°C) so it’s nice and hot for those crispy edges.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per for easy cleanup.
Prepare Your Tortillas: Lay out your low-carb tortillas on a clean surface. Make sure they’re flat so you can fill them without any fuss.
Add Cheese and Toppings: Generously sprinkle shredded mozzarella on each tortilla followed by pepperoni slices. Don’t skimp! You want every bite loaded with flavor.
Season It Up!: Sprinkle Italian seasoning and garlic powder evenly over the toppings. This adds an aromatic layer that will make your kitchen smell amazing!
Roll It Up!: Carefully roll each tortilla tightly from one end to the other like you’re wrapping up a precious gift. Securely tuck in any filling that tries to escape!
Bake Until Golden Brown: Place your rolled-up beauties seam-side down on the baking sheet. Spray lightly with olive oil and bake for about 15-20 minutes until golden brown and bubbly.

Storing & Reheating
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. To reheat, pop them in the oven at 350°F until warmed through for that fresh-out-of-the-oven taste.

FAQ
What kind of low-carb tortillas work best?
You can use almond flour or coconut flour tortillas for a low-carb option. They hold up well and have a great taste that complements the cheesy filling.
Can I freeze Cheesy Pepperoni Pizza Roll-Ups?
Absolutely! You can freeze them before baking. Just wrap them tightly in foil or plastic wrap, and bake from frozen when you’re ready to enjoy.

Cheesy Pepperoni Pizza Roll-Ups with Low-Carb Tortillas
- Total Time: 30 minutes
- Yield: Serves 4 (8 roll-ups) 1x
Description
Cheesy Pepperoni Pizza Roll-Ups are a delectable low-carb snack, bursting with gooey cheese and spicy pepperoni. Perfect for parties or cozy nights in!
Ingredients
- 4 low-carb tortillas
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- 20 pepperoni slices
- 1 tsp Italian seasoning
- 1/2 tsp garlic powder
- Olive oil spray
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Lay out the low-carb tortillas flat on a clean surface.
- Evenly sprinkle shredded mozzarella over each tortilla, followed by the pepperoni slices.
- Season with Italian seasoning and garlic powder.
- Roll each tortilla tightly from one end to the other, tucking in fillings as needed.
- Place the rolled tortillas seam-side down on the baking sheet, spray lightly with olive oil, and bake for 15-20 minutes until golden brown.
